ATTRIBUTES OF ALLAH
Allah! There is no God save Him, the Alive, the Eternal. Neither slumber nor sleep overtaketh Him. Unto Him belongeth whatsoever is in the heavens and whatsoever is in the earth. Who is he that intercedeth with Him save by His leave? He knoweth that which is in front of them and that which is behind them, while they encompass nothing of His knowledge save what He will. His throne includeth the heavens and the earth, and He is never weary of preserving them. He is the Sublime, the Tremendous.(2. 255).
No vision can grasp Him, but His grasp is over all vision. He is above all comprehension. (6. 103).
Such is He, the Knower of all things, hidden and open, the Exalted, the Merciful. (32. 6).
It is He Who is
Allah
in Heaven and
Allah
in earth, he is full of Wisdom and Knowledge. To Him belongs the dominions of the heavens and the earth, and all between them. With Him is the knowledge of the Hour of Judgement, and to Him you shall all be brought back (43. 84-85).
He is the First and the Last, and the Outward and the Inward; and He is Knower of all things. (57. 3).
Allah
is He than Whom there is no other god. He knows all things, both secret and open. He is Most Gracious, Most Merciful. (59. 22).
Allah
is He than Whom there is no other god, the Sovereign, the Holy One, the Source of Peace and Perfection, the Guardian of Faith, the Preserver of Safety, the Exalted, the Mighty, the Irresistible, the Supreme, above all partners (59. 23).
He is
Allah
the Creator, the Evolver, the Bestower of Forms. To Him belong the Most Beautiful Names. (59. 24).
He is
Allah
the One and Only, Allah the Eternal, Absolute. He begets not, nor is He begotten, and there is none like Him. (Surah:112. 1-4).
ALLAH-MOST BEAUTIFUL NAMES
Most beautiful names belong to Allah, and
the believers are enjoined to call upon Allah
by such beautiful names : Asma-ul-Husna.
The most beautiful names belong to Allah. So call Him by such names, but shun such men who refer to Him with profanity. What you do would be requited. (7. 180).
Call upon Allah. Call upon Rahmaan. By whatever beautiful name you call upon Him it is well, for to Him belong the most beautiful names. (17. 110).
Allah; there is no god but He. To Him belongs the most beautiful names. (20. 8).
He is Allah, the Creator, the Shaper out of naught, the Fashioner. His are the most beautiful names. All that is in the heavens and the earth glorifieth Him, and He is the Mighty, the Wise. (59. 24).
ALLAH-THE OMNISCIENT
One of the attributes of Allah is that He is omniscient. He has perfect knowledge of all things hidden or open.
Of all things Allah
has perfect knowledge. (2. 29).
Allah
knows the secrets of heaven and earth, and He knows what you reveal and what you conceal.
(2. 33).
Do not conceal evidence for Allah
knows all that you do (2. 283).
Whether you show what is in your mind or conceal it, Allah is well aware of that and will call you to, account
therefore. (2. 284).
From Allah
verily, nothing is hidden on earth or in the heavens. (3. 5).
Whatever you hide what is in your hearts or reveal it, Allah knows it all. He knows what is in the Heavens and what is on earth. (3. 29).
Allah
knows well all the secrets of the heart.(2.119).
Allah
knows what you hide and what you reveal and He knows the recompense which you earn by your deeds. (6. 3).
With Allah
are the keys of the unseen treasures that none know but He. He knows whatever there is on the earth and in the sea. Not a leaf falls but with His knowledge. There is not a grain in the darkness of the earth nor anything fresh or dry of which He does not have knowledge. (6. 59).
It is He Who takes your souls by night and has knowledge of all that you have done by day. (6. 60).
He it is Who created the heavens and the earth in truth. In that day when He saith: Be! it is.. His word is the truth, and His will be the Sovereignty on the day when the trumpet is blown. Knower of the invisible and the visible, He is the Wise, the Aware. (6. 73).
Allah
knows best who stray from His Way. He knows best who they are that receive His guidance. (6. 117).
Allah
knows what every female womb bears, by how much the wombs fall short of their time. Every single thing is before His sight. (13. 8).
Allah
knows the unseen and the seen. (13. 9).
It is the same to Him whether any of you conceal his speech or declare it openly, whether he lies hidden by night, or walks forth freely by day. (13.10).
Undoubtedly Allah
knows what they conceal and what they reveal. (16. 23).
Verily the knowledge of the Hour is with Allah
alone. It is He Who sends down rain, and it is He Who knows what is in the womb. Nor does any one know what it is that he will earn on the morrow. Nor does any one know in what land he is to die. Verily with
Allah
is full knowledge and He is acquainted with all things. (21. 34).
He knoweth that which goeth down into the earth and that which cometh forth from it, and that which descendeth from the heaven and that which ascendeth into it. He is the Merciful, the Forgiving.(34. 2).
He knoweth all that is in the heavens and all that is in the earth, and He knoweth what ye conceal and what ye publish. and
Allah
is Aware of what is in the breasts (of men). (64. 4).
ALLAH-THE PLANNER
When the Quraysh of Makkah came to know that the Holy Prophet
Sal Allaho Alehe Wasallam and his followers were planning migration to Madinah, they held a counsel of war and hit upon a plan. According to the plan, each section of the Quraysh picked out its bravest young men. The young men from all the sections were to surround the house of the Holy Prophet
Sal Allaho Alehe Wasallam by night. The plan was that when the Holy Prophet
Sal Allaho Alehe Wasallam came out of the house in the morning, all the young men were to fall on the Holy Prophet
Sal Allaho Alehe Wasallam and kill him.
Allah revealed the plot to the Holy Prophet Sal
Allaho Alehe Wasallam. The Holy Prophet
Sal Allaho Alehe Wasallam left Hazrat Ali Raziallah
Anho in his bed, and himself left along with Hazrat Abu Bakr Raziallah
Anho, and sought shelter in a cave in Mountain Thaur outside Makkah. This event is referred to in Surah 8.
And remember when the disbelievers made their plan to confine you, or kill you, or expel you, they made their plans and
Allah
made His plan, and
Allah
is the best of Planners. (8. 30).
